LA Knight has made it to the semi-final of the Last Time is Now Tournament. The Megastar defeated Zack Ryder in the first round and The Miz in the quarter-final. He will now face Jey Uso for a spot in the final of the tournament.

Fans are expecting Gunther vs. Jey Uso to run it back in the final, meaning Knight will likely end up losing to The YEET Master. However, the Triple H-led creative team could swerve everyone by turning The Megastar heel and having him defeat Jey. Not only that, but the heel turn may come in the most unexpected of ways.

In an interesting possibility, LA Knight could turn heel and introduce his real-life partner, Michelle Yavulla, to WWE. Michelle has appeared with Knight at the last three Hall of Fame ceremonies. The couple could take their relationship on-screen and dominate the global juggernaut together.

Having Knight's real-life girlfriend join him on television as a villain would add an interesting layer to his character. We have seen many heel couples on-screen throughout the years, and it has mostly been entertaining.

The former United States Champion has had several setbacks lately, and a turn to the dark side could re-establish him as a major star. That said, this scenario is purely based on speculation.


LA Knight to win his first world title soon?

LA Knight has been on a quest to win his first world title in WWE. However, despite several attempts, The Megastar has failed to accomplish his goal. Knight has lost every big match he has been part of this year, and fans are glad to see him perform well in the Last Time is Now Tournament.

It is unlikely that the 43-year-old star would go on to face John Cena in his final match, as Gunther is heavily rumored to face The GOAT on December 13. That said, if The Megastar turns heel, he could enter into the World Heavyweight Title picture once again.

LA Knight and CM Punk had issues with each other for months, but their rivalry ended before it could properly begin. That said, the creative team could reignite their feud with the World Heavyweight Title on the line. Punk had mocked The Megastar for never winning a world title in WWE. It would certainly be poetic if Knight won his first world championship by defeating The Second City Saint.

That said, this is also speculation, and nothing has been confirmed.
